Please use the standard names for these binding.
The first books in the HH series were MPB or MMPB, mass-market paperback. These are the typical pocket sized books. I think book 25 changed how and when the bindings were released with first HB, hardback, then TP, trade paperback, and finally MPB. The HB and TP contained illustrations not included in the MPB.
The foil color on the original MPBs indicated the pint run. A gold foiled MPB of Horus Rising would be a first, first pint.
